Main duties of the job
* Manage a caseload of both primary and secondary care patients with varying diagnosis and or /complex needs, using evidence based/ client centred principles to assess, plan, implement and evaluate interventions in a defined clinical area.
* Ensure development of junior staff through supervision, training and annual appraisal.
* Participate in the planning, development and evaluation of clinical practice & service development within area.
* Contribute to the maintenance and development of the Trust Physiotherapy service.
* Take a lead for information management to ensure high quality data which is recorded, evaluated & reported in a timely manner.
Job responsibilities
* Be professional, legally responsible & accountable for all aspects of own work and activities, to manage clinical risk within own clinical caseload.
* Carry a clinical caseload of highly complex patients, provide advanced therapeutic assessment & evaluation and provide detailed written treatment plans with patient centred goals working within ward / department areas.
* Work as an autonomous practitioner and member of the multidisciplinary team, contributing to team discussions and influencing decisions about patient care programs, taking on the role of care Co‑Ordinator and/ or vocational lead where relevant.
* Carry out treatment, using a broad variety of modalities and clinical reasoning to allow selection of the most appropriate technique evaluating, modifying and recording all interventions and outcomes & adapting them to meet the needs of the patient.
* Use highly developed manual treatment skills requiring coordination, sensation & dexterity.
* Produce and deliver an annual report specific to own clinical area & participate in the delivery of the Physiotherapy business plan.
